The place of Tinajas Segunda Sección is inside the municipality of Tepeji del Río de Ocampo (in the State of Hidalgo). There are 7 inhabitants. Of all the towns in the municipality, it occupies the number #52 in terms of number of inhabitants. Tinajas Segunda Sección is at 2,383 meters of altitude.

Data: In Tinajas Segunda Sección, 43% of individuals have completed secondary education and 0% of households have a personal computer, laptop or tablet. More interesting data at the bottom of this page.

The town of Tinajas Segunda Sección is located at 4.7 kilometers from Tepeji de Ocampo, which is the most populated locality in the municipality, in the West direction. If you browse our webpage, you will also find a map with the location of Tinajas Segunda Sección.

#6 The Postal Code of Tinajas Segunda Sección (Hidalgo) is 42884

Are you going to send a letter to Tinajas Segunda Sección? Do you have a friend in Tinajas Segunda Sección and want to send them a gift through the postal service? The Postal Code of Tinajas Segunda Sección consists of the following 5 digits: 42884. If you want to know more about how Post Codes are determined in Mexico, the first two postal digits of Tinajas Segunda Sección ("42") correspond to the state code of Hidalgo, and the last three correspond to the people themselves. In Mexico, the same ZIP code can be assigned to several towns.
